When it comes to digitalizing your business, a mobile app or a web app is the best way to go. But spending a huge chunk of money during the process of app development might not be suitable for all business/product owners. Everyone is looking to have a cost-effective solution, but are you aware of the key elements that can help you save a huge cost? Keep reading to find out!
Here are 5 ways through which you can minimize your cost:
- Creating a plan of what you want
- Finding the right technology
- Choosing the platforms
- Careful designing and prototypes
- Outsourcing developers
1. Creating a plan of what you want
Before you proceed with design and development, you should have a complete plan about what you want to build and how you can build it in a cost-effective way. Not deciding on the features of the app, proceeding without a detailed design, and not setting the appropriate outcomes the app is supposed to provide, will result in constant reiterations and will only raise your cost. Once you have the app idea here is what you should do:
Create a detailed document of the features/functions of the app
List down the UI/UX tweaks you want in the app. Just a rough idea of how you want the app to look like
Divide each task into milestones and proceed to the next step only when the previous milestone is achieved
If you want to find out a detailed method of how to plan and execute an app, read more at You can build the next million-dollar app with these 9 easy steps
2. Finding the right technology
Each language and framework you use for the development of your mobile or web app has a different cost. The cost of backend technology for the development of a mobile app, or the cost of a server for hosting a website is dependent on the features, audience, and functions the app has to deliver. Custom backend development of an app will cost more than a pre-made backend technology such as Firebase or Parse. For making the right choice, you should consult an app development agency and discuss with a professional about pros and cons of different technologies.
3. Choosing the platforms
If you are designing a mobile app then you can get the app for Android, iOS (Apple), or both. But if you want to save your cost, there can be two approaches you can use
1. If you are certain that you want your app to be available to both android and apple users, then opt for the cross-platform development method instead of getting both apps built on their native platforms. Cross-platform development allows your app to be used across multiple platforms with a one-time development cost, thus making it a more cost-saving choice. Read more at Native Or Cross-platform, What’s More Profitable?
2. If you are uncertain about the result and success of the app, then it is wise to test it on one platform first (either android or iOS). This will give you time to analyze the results on one platform while saving your cost of development on the other platform. And if your app is successful, then you can get it developed for other platform as well, this time with more experience of the whole process of app development
Looking for guidance about the platforms? Reach out to professionals
4. Careful designing and prototypes
Good wireframing and prototyping is the key to saving cost during the development of an app. The reason is that prototypes and wireframes serve as a sample of the app that allows you to see the flow, usability, and interactions the app will provide. If there is a UI/UX element that you do not like, it can be easily modified during the design procedure. Flow and interactions of the app can also be altered during design. But modifying these details after they have been developed, will be complicated and costly. Therefore, a special focus should be put on the design processes regardless of the time consumption to ensure a good prototype that does not require modifications and iterations after development.
5. Outsourcing developers
The outsourcing model is growing rapidly around the globe due to several benefits and IT services such as mobile app development and web app development are the most commonly outsourced. This is another factor that can cause a huge dent in your cost. Freelancers and remote developers are experts in their fields and charge you less than a professional company or an in-house hired employee, making them a better and more cost-effective choice. There are multiple platforms where you can find the right developers and if you are looking to save even more, then fresh freelancers from developing countries like Pakistan, India, Philippines etc. will be the best choice
Fun Fact: Pakistan is ranked as the 4th most popular country for freelancing and is consistently ranked among the top destinations for outsourcing because of the exponential growth of the IT sector.
I want to connect with professional developers
The End-Note
If you carefully plan your steps and work on milestones then it is possible that you avoid any extra costs that may be in your way towards digitization. But it is important to have a realistic budget when you are opting for an app or web development service, so you can get the best results
Get Quote
Get Quote